Canada’s Wonderland launches Halloween season with three new mazes at Haunt and kid-friendly fun at Camp Spooky

The spookiest time of year is back at Canada’s Wonderland this month with Halloween Haunt returning for its 18th season starting Sept. 22 with more dates than ever before and three new terrifying mazes: Dark Ride, Necropolis and Trick or Treat Street. Camp Spooky daytime fun for kids and families starts Sept. 23 with costume parties, trick-or-treating and live entertainment with the PEANUTS Gang.

Halloween Haunt
Nighttime thrills return with Haunt beginning Friday, Sept. 22 and running for 20 select nights through
Oct. 29. Hundreds of monsters will be unleashed upon the park and guests can brave seven mazes, five
scare zones, see six sinister shows and ride all their favourite roller coasters in the dark!

Camp Spooky Family-friendly Halloween fun with Snoopy and the PEANUTS Gang returns weekend this fall with Camp Spooky starting Saturday, Sept. 23 featuring scare-free attractions, live shows, costume parties, trick-or-treating and more.
